Leveraging Data Analytics for Hyper-Personalization
The digital shift has transformed news consumption into a highly personalized experience. For Dainik Bhaskar, understanding its diverse readership, spanning various demographics and geographical regions, is paramount. This is where big data analytics comes into play. The media house employs robust data pipelines to collect, process, and analyze vast amounts of user interaction data – everything from article views, time spent on pages, click-through rates, and preferred content categories.
They utilize machine learning algorithms, often built on frameworks like Apache Spark or TensorFlow, to identify reading patterns and predict user interests. This enables the implementation of recommendation engines, similar to those found on streaming platforms, suggesting articles, videos, and even advertisements tailored to individual preferences. For instance, a reader frequently engaging with business news might see more financial content, while another interested in local politics receives relevant regional updates. This hyper-personalization extends beyond content, optimizing advertisement placement for higher engagement and revenue. The strategic use of A/B testing frameworks allows their digital teams to continuously refine content layouts, headline choices, and notification strategies, ensuring maximum reader retention and engagement. This data-driven approach moves beyond mere traffic counting, focusing on deeper engagement metrics and user journey mapping to cultivate a loyal digital readership.
Cloud Infrastructure and Scalability for Digital Reach
Maintaining a consistent and high-performance digital presence for millions of daily active users requires a resilient and scalable infrastructure. Dainik Bhaskar, like many modern digital publishers, has heavily invested in cloud computing solutions. Moving away from traditional on-premise servers, they leverage public cloud providers such as Amazon Web Services (AWS), Google Cloud Platform (GCP), or Microsoft Azure. This transition offers unparalleled scalability, allowing their platforms to handle sudden spikes in traffic during breaking news events without service interruption.
Their architecture likely incorporates microservices, containerization technologies like Docker and Kubernetes, to manage various components of their digital platform – from content management systems (CMS) and user authentication to ad serving and analytics engines. Content Delivery Networks (CDNs) like Akamai or Cloudflare are crucial for ensuring low-latency content delivery to users across India and globally, caching static assets and even dynamic content closer to the end-user. This distributed architecture not only enhances performance but also improves disaster recovery capabilities, ensuring business continuity even in the face of regional outages. The adoption of Infrastructure as Code (IaC) principles, using tools like Terraform or Ansible, streamlines the deployment and management of this complex cloud environment, enabling rapid iteration and consistent configuration across all their digital properties.
AI in Newsroom Operations and Content Creation
Artificial intelligence is not just for tech giants; it's increasingly becoming an indispensable tool in modern newsrooms. Dainik Bhaskar is exploring and implementing AI to enhance various aspects of its operations, from content optimization to journalistic support.
One significant application is in content moderation and sentiment analysis. AI algorithms can rapidly process user comments and forum discussions, identifying hate speech, misinformation, or spam, thereby maintaining a healthy online community. Furthermore, natural language processing (NLP) models are being utilized to analyze vast amounts of textual data, assisting journalists in sifting through reports, identifying trends, and even generating preliminary drafts for data-heavy articles, such as financial summaries or sports statistics. While AI won't replace human journalists, it acts as a powerful co-pilot, automating repetitive tasks and providing valuable insights that accelerate research and content production.
AI also plays a role in optimizing content for search engines and social media. Machine learning models can predict which headlines are likely to perform best, suggest optimal publishing times, and even automate the creation of social media snippets. The integration of AI-powered translation services can also help broaden their reach, making content accessible to a wider non-Hindi speaking audience, further expanding their digital footprint.
Mobile-First Development and User Experience (UX)
In a country like India, where mobile internet penetration far outstrips desktop usage, a mobile-first strategy is not just an advantage but a necessity. Dainik Bhaskar has invested heavily in developing highly optimized mobile applications and responsive web designs to cater to this audience. Their development teams focus on creating intuitive user interfaces (UI) and seamless user experiences (UX) that prioritize speed, ease of navigation, and content readability on smaller screens.
This involves employing modern front-end frameworks like React Native or Flutter for cross-platform mobile development, ensuring a consistent experience across iOS and Android. Features such as push notifications are strategically used to deliver breaking news and personalized content alerts directly to users, fostering immediate engagement. Interactive elements, such as polls, quizzes, and comment sections, are designed to encourage user participation and build community. Furthermore, accessibility features are integrated to ensure the platform is usable by individuals with diverse needs. The constant iteration based on user feedback and analytics data ensures that their mobile platforms remain at the forefront of digital news consumption, offering a compelling and engaging experience that keeps readers coming back.
